A section of the High Street in Ryde has been cordoned off by Police this afternoon (Wednesday) amid a medical incident, in which an elderly individual is being tended to in the middle of the road. Police and paramedics are on scene near the laundrette at the junction of the upper High Street and St Johns Road. Island Echo understands an elderly individual suffered a medical episode shortly before 14:30 and was initially assisted by passing members of the public. No road traffic collision has taken place. Paramedics from the Isle of Wight Ambulance Service are now tending to the patient, supported by members of the public and Police. Hampshire & Isle of Wight Constabulary has closed the one-way street at both ends with cordons now in place.
Children leaving nearby Ryde Academy – and other pedestrians – are being diverted away from the scene via Prince Street and/or West Street. Traffic is heavy in the area so motorists should allow extra time for local journeys.
